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,014 in Mexicali versus $1,423 in Guadalajara.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,624 in Mexicali versus $2,301 in Guadalajara.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$2,233 in Mexicali versus $3,179 in Guadalajara.

Living in Mexicali costs roughly 29% less than in Guadalajara,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

The two cities straddle the global median: Mexicali is 26% below, Guadalajara is 3% above.

Cost Breakdown

A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$1,064 in Mexicali and $893 in Guadalajara.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.

Mexicali pays 11% more on average while also being the cheaper of the two. The combined effect is a noticeably stronger local purchasing power.

Dining out: $37.00 in Mexicali vs $51.0 in Guadalajara for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$212 vs $296 per month, with Mexicali cheaper across the board.
